I. Introduction: The Unique Position of France Lyon in Global Finance

Welcome to this comprehensive Seminar Presentation Slides. Today, we delve into the evolving role of the professional financial intermediary within one of Europe’s most dynamic economic hubs.

France Lyon, situated at the confluence of the Rhône and Saône rivers, is historically known as a city of silk merchants and bankers. Since the Renaissance, it has been synonymous with wealth management, private banking excellence, and international trade finance. Today,
France Lyon remains a critical node in European finance but faces unprecedented digital transformation.

This presentation explores how the contemporary Banker must balance the rich heritage of this region with aggressive technological adoption to remain relevant in an increasingly borderless financial ecosystem.

III. The Evolution of the Modern Banker

The traditional image of a Banker
sitting behind an oak desk is obsolete. In today's landscape, particularly in major European hubs like France Lyon, the role has evolved significantly:

  • Digital Fluency: A modern banker must possess technical literacy in data analytics and artificial intelligence.
  • Ethical Stewardship: Post-2008 financial crisis, trust has been rebuilt through transparency and compliance.
  • Sustainability Focus: The rise of ESG (Environmental, Social, and Governance) criteria requires bankers to advise clients on green investments. This is especially relevant in France Lyon’s growing eco-friendly urban planning initiatives.



IV. The Digital Transformation in France Lyon

The landscape of banking in France Lyon is undergoing a seismic shift driven by fintech startups and legacy banks adapting to digital demands.

  • Fintech Integration:Lyon has emerged as a prominent hub for fintech innovation, hosting numerous accelerators focused on blockchain, cybersecurity, and automated advisory services. A forward-thinking banker in this region must collaborate with these startups rather than compete against them.
  • Digital Banking Platforms:Clients in France Lyon increasingly expect seamless mobile banking experiences. Traditional institutions are investing heavily to match the user interface simplicity of digital-only challengers.

VII. Future Outlook: Sustainability and Innovation

The future of the banking sector in France Lyon points toward sustainable finance.

  • Green Bonds:Banks are increasingly financing renewable energy projects within the Auvergne-Rhône-Alpes region. The modern banker is tasked with identifying viable green investments that offer competitive returns while contributing to climate goals.
  • Digital Assets: As central bank digital currencies (CBDCs) evolve, bankers must stay informed about their potential impact on cross-border transactions and local commerce.
